Celebrities living in Dubai are turning the city into one of the world's most desirable addresses for global icons. With luxury living, modern architecture, strong privacy laws, and a genuinely multicultural lifestyle, Dubai has become a permanent home for Hollywood actresses, sports champions, and beauty moguls alike. Some stars have recently made the move; others have spent years building their careers from the UAE.

New Celebrity Residents in Dubai

Arabella Chi

Former Love Island star Arabella Chi has moved to Dubai with her partner Billy Henty and their newborn daughter, Gigi. She announced the move on social media, calling it a new chapter for their family.

Rio Ferdinand

Football legend Rio Ferdinand relocated with his family, highlighting Dubai's lifestyle, safety, and high-quality schools as the key reasons behind the decision.

Ronan Keating

Irish music star Ronan Keating and his wife Storm have settled in Dubai with their children. Keating also performed live at the Dubai Media City Amphitheatre on November 21, 2025.

Sushmita Sen

Former Miss Universe and actress Sushmita Sen lives in Dubai while managing her acting projects and business ventures, including her role as part-owner of a luxury jewellery brand.

Khamzat Chimaev

UFC middleweight champion Khamzat Chimaev has made Dubai his training base. He is regularly spotted working out at TKMMA Fit in Media City.

Celebrities Who Have Called Dubai Home for Years

Lindsay Lohan

Hollywood actress Lindsay Lohan moved to Dubai in 2014 seeking greater privacy. She married financier Bader Shammas in 2022, and the couple welcomed their son, Luai, in 2023. Her story remains one of the most well-known celebrity relocations to the UAE.

Jo Malone

Fragrance entrepreneur Jo Malone relocated to Dubai in 2021. She lives with her husband in a luxury hotel and continues to pursue new creative projects from the city.

Huda Kattan

Beauty mogul Huda Kattan moved to Dubai in 2006 and built her global brand, Huda Beauty, from the city. She remains one of Dubai's most influential entrepreneurs and owns a nine-bedroom villa on Palm Jumeirah.

Global Stars with Dubai Golden Visas

Several international icons hold Dubai's Golden Visa through investment and business initiatives. Cristiano Ronaldo, who received his Golden Visa in 2020 and invested in a Jumeirah Bay Island mansion, and Giorgio Armani are among the most prominent names on the list. Since 2021, an estimated 1,500-plus influencers have received the Golden Visa across industries from fashion to gaming.

As Dubai continues to grow as a luxury lifestyle destination, the number of celebrities living in Dubai is expected to rise even further.
